There Was Childishness in Me
I was childish; my behavior was immature.
("And the Rabbi said: 'Childishness was in me, and I was brazen-faced before Nathan the Babylonian'" — Bava Batra 21a; and likewise: 'And as the years passed, when I had eaten from the tree of knowledge of good and evil and my mind had matured... I saw that there was no childishness in me' — Berdyczewski, Writings, 2, 83; and likewise: 'How I loved her voice. Many times I opened the door so that she would ask who is there. Childishness was in me' — Agnon, On the Latch Handles, 5)
